There is no cheap solution when it comes to mac. You should get a fast hard drive (ssd) and good storage for your media (not usb 2, not 5400rpm drives). The power of resolve comes from GFX cards. Apple are generally behind in putting very powerful GFX cards in their machines and only the most expensive have a discreet graphics card, the rest have the built in intel Iris stuff which will not help you out much at all.
If it has to be cheap build a desktop PC, you will pay way way less than a mac laptop but you will get a real video card and you can make it a good one (get two, have one for the GUI and one for resolve).
I have the latest and best retina laptop (with NVIDIA GeForce GT 750M, which is outdated but the best you can get from apple in a laptop), it does an OK job of 1080i footage in resolve, but it is disappointing compared to a desktop PC that costs half the price.
Save up some more money, and get computer with a very good graphics card (>2gb memory)
